5 out of 5 stars Just great!   September 8, 2008
We purchased a couple of these when they had an awesome rebate program going on. Our main use is for our Canon Rebel XT(Yes, I know it takes compact flash cards but you can get an inexpensive reader that works wonders with it and lets it work in the Canon).

First, the card comes with some nice stuff! The USB Card Reader it comes with is nice and handy. You plug it into a USB port and plug the card in to it and it reads very quickly!

It also has a nice, hard plastic carrying case that it comes with. To top it off, it also comes with a nice carrying pouch too!

The speed on this thing is amazing! With the Canon we have it takes picture after picture with no lag. There has been no error messages with the card either.

With 4gbs of storage this card is a must have if you're taking lots of pictures and need a fast card!

5 out of 5 stars Big Storage, Fast, Small, Works Well   September 6, 2008
After a bad experience with another cheaper brand, I bought this SanDisk for a Kodak V1073 camera. The amount of storage is great, it recently allowed to take photos and movies for an entire vacation trip without changing the memory. The Extreme III is very fast to write with the camera and read with the USB reader. The reader is small enough to be carried in a camera bag without concern for space or weight. Since SDHC is not widespread yet, this kit with the included reader is a great buy. Highly recommended.


5 out of 5 stars A regular person uses the Extreme III   September 4, 2008
After researching the compatibility of memory cards with our Canon S5 IS Powershot digital camera (I read a number of reviews to confirm that the 4GB Extreme III SDHC card would work with our camera), I ordered three cards when I found I could get a fantastic rebate from Sandisk with the purchase of three so the final cost was less than any other 1GB card I looked at (offer no longer available).

Because we used the higher resolution setting for the video function for our camera for a two week trip overseas this summer, we needed all of that memory. It was really helpful to have the extra cards because we were not able to download to a computer right away.


We are not professionals so we don't know what else the card can do besides hold lots of higher resolution video, but it works well for that purpose. Also, if you wanted to take hundreds of still photos without having to stop for a new card or couldn't download right away, it would be great too.

Random notes: My husband observed that the 4GB lasted longer than two, 2GB Ultra II Sandisk cards. The Canon we have is a digital with a very nice video function, not a dedicated video recorder, so I think it takes more memory for video. We are not sophisticated users, just very satisfied point-and-shooters.
